=== 2015 shooting ===
On October 9, 2015, Steven Edward Jones, an 18-year-old freshman at Northern Arizona University, shot four people, killing Colin Charles Brough and severely injuring three others, in a parking lot outside of Mountain View Hall on the Flagstaff Mountain campus.
Jones was charged with one count of first-degree murder and three counts of aggravated assault. He pleaded not guilty, taking responsibility for the shooting but saying that he acted in self-defense.
=== 2020s to present ===
In 2022, José Luis Cruz Rivera became the university's 17th president. In 2023, the university announced the establishment of NAU Health initiative, which will include the creation of a medical school through the College of Medicine.
